Seabourn Announces Sale of up to 65% on Europe and Asia Voyages in 2010

The Yachts of Seabourn has announced an expansion of its “Yachting Collection Savings” promotion to include the entire 2010 season of European and Asian cruises aboard the line’s intimate, all-suite luxury fleet. Savings of 45 to 65 percent result in all-inclusive fares starting from $2,749 per person, based on double occupancy of an ocean-view suite measuring 277 square feet or larger.

The promotion includes nearly 150 cruises of seven to 14 days aboard the award-winning Seabourn Pride, Spirit and Legend, as well as the newly-launched Seabourn Odyssey, already hailed as “…a game-changer for the luxury cruise segment,” and its sister-yacht Seabourn Sojourn, which will debut in June 2010 in London. Yachting Collection Savings have already been announced for Seabourn’s first-quarter cruises in Southeast Asia, South and Central America and the Caribbean. The expansion adds an extensive array of voyages in Europe from Iceland, Norway and the Baltic across the whole span of the Mediterranean and the Black Sea. In Asia, Seabourn Pride’s voyages in Vietnam and Thailand are included, as well as brand-new itineraries exploring China, Korea and Japan.
